News/Information Update

I added the sad information of Kanabe Miyuki's death to her profile in the Musicals section under Cast- Sailormoon. Though this is relatively old news, for those who are unfamiliar with her Miyuki played the role of Sailormoon third in the Sailormoon Musicals run, beating out 500 other girls who auditioned for the role.

She had been struggling with poor health for a while recently until she finally passed away from heart failure on June 18th, 2008.

Stardust Magic

Minor update notice for the first of July! I've been working to get out as many new, updated gifs for the magic section as possible. I have about 1/2 of them done now, so there's only about 30 left that I need for the anime. Included in this update is gifs for some of the rarer attacks in Sailormoon; including Sailor Body Attack!, Sailor Moon Kick!, and Super Supreme Thunder!. I'm working on completing the entire set, though. I realize having 30 left seems like a high number, but really it is quite a bit fewer than before. The bulk of the ones missing are transformations, I have most of the attacks made into new gifs. After I've completed the general set, I'll go back and make gif files of secondary versions of the same attacks- for example, all the Starlights have two different transformation sequences and two different attack sequences. I'm putting the longer, more complete versions of these up first but plan on making the other versions on as a secondary link later.

The quality of these animations are higher than the previous ones were. I noticed on a lot of our old files, the whole thing was shortened significantly- like taking out all the ribbons in Moon Prism Power, Make Up! or leaving out the water vortex in Neptune Planet Power, Make Up!. All the animations I've made have the full versions and are also (fairly) large so that you can see everything much easier. The only down side to this is that the files are also larger, making them take a bit longer to load. This isn't a big deal for people with uuber-fast internet, but the warning is out there for people still stuck on dial-up.
